项目简介
本项目是基于TM4C123 ARM微控制器开发的实时时钟系统,具备闹钟设置功能。系统通过I2C总线与PCF8563实时时钟芯片通信,利用四个七段显示器显示时间,用户可通过按钮更新时间和设置闹钟。
项目的主要特性和功能
- 实时时钟功能:可从PCF8563芯片实时读取时间,并在七段显示器上显示。
- 闹钟设置功能:支持用户设置闹钟时间,到达指定时间触发闹钟。
- 时间设置功能:用户能通过按钮手动设置时间。
- 中断驱动:利用中断响应按钮输入和闹钟事件。
安装使用步骤
- 确保已下载项目源码文件。
- 硬件连接:依据项目文件说明,连接TM4C123 ARM微控制器、PCF8563芯片、七段显示器和按钮。
- 编译代码:使用ARM编译器编译
clock.c
文件。 - 烧录程序:将编译后的程序烧录到TM4C123 ARM微控制器。
- 测试运行:系统上电后,七段显示器显示当前时间,可通过按钮设置时间和闹钟。闹钟时间到达时,系统触发闹钟。
注意:详细硬件连接和操作说明请参考项目文件。本项目假设用户熟悉基本硬件连接和ARM编程环境。如需更详细操作指南,建议查阅相关文档。
下载地址
点击下载 【提取码: 4003】【解压密码: www.makuang.net】